Immerse yourself in history by visiting Yvoire, a medieval gem nestled within centuries-old ramparts. This village, proudly recognized as one of the “Most Beautiful Villages of France,” celebrated the 700th anniversary of its founding in 2006.

Discover treasures preserved since the 14th century: majestic gates, imposing ramparts, and an iconic castle. Once a fishing village on the shores of Lake Geneva, Yvoire is now a major tourist destination, acclaimed both nationally and across Europe for its remarkable floral displays.
